Then a ride down to Brighton<\/a> on Sunday to take part in the Brighton Burn-Up. This ride commemorates the brawls between the Rockers and Mods back in the 60’s. There are motorcycles and scooters everywhere!<\/p>\n

Then on our ride back to London, we come to a complete halt! All traffic in both directions of the M23 had stopped and the motorway was closed. Evidentially, a car hit a motorcyclist in our lane, sent him in to the oncoming traffic lane and was hit again. Sadly, he was pronounced dead at the scene! We waited there for a couple of hours until the authorities had us all turn around and drive the wrong way to the nearest exit.<\/p>\n

And for you Dracula fans, a photo of my Guzzi positioned in front of Whitby Abbey. Whitby, North Yorkshire is supposedly where Count Dracula’s coffin washed ashore when the ship he was sailing on wrecked and the Abbey is where he is rumoured to have been buried. There used to be a grave stone that was marked Alucard (Dracula spelled backwards), but it’s no longer there. The curators claim it was only a legend and was never really there, but I saw it many years ago, so know they are talking nonsense!<\/p>\n
